Output 87bed7aa1f44962331d0d0579870a554fc18a7d86b1f632d66eb826d7902a816:0

value
17417
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a96e03c84ceeef23f1b8d07ecfc674705916beef OP_EQUAL
address
3H8suvXVu8ZDCsS2aaSjF89Lq1pQ3bQQkb
transaction
87bed7aa1f44962331d0d0579870a554fc18a7d86b1f632d66eb826d7902a816
confirmations
224974
spent
true